The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
May. 24, 2011

Filed:

Mar. 30, 2007
Applicants:

Alan T. Ruberg, Menlo Park, CA (US);

Dae Kyeung Kim, San Jose, CA (US);

Daeyun Shim, Cupertino, CA (US);

Dongyun Lee, San Jose, CA (US);

Myung Rai Cho, San Jose, CA (US);

Sungjoon Kim, Cupertino, CA (US);

Inventors:

Alan T. Ruberg, Menlo Park, CA (US);

Dae Kyeung Kim, San Jose, CA (US);

Daeyun Shim, Cupertino, CA (US);

Dongyun Lee, San Jose, CA (US);

Myung Rai Cho, San Jose, CA (US);

Sungjoon Kim, Cupertino, CA (US);

Assignee:

Silicon Image, Inc., Sunnyvale, CA (US);

Attorney:
Primary Examiner:
Int. Cl.
CPC ...
G06F 9/48 (2006.01); G06F 15/76 (2006.01);
U.S. Cl.
CPC ...
Abstract

A method and system for inter-port communication utilizing a multi-port memory device. The memory device contains an interrupt register, an interrupt signal interface (e.g., a dedicated pin), an interrupt mask, and one or more message buffers associated with each port. When a first component coupled to a first port of the memory device wants to communicate with a second component coupled to a second port of the memory device, the first component writes a message to a message buffer associated with the second port. An interrupt in the input register of the second port is set to notify the second component coupled to the second port that a new message is available. Upon receiving the interrupt, the second component reads the interrupt register to determine the nature of the interrupt. The second component then reads the message from the message buffer.


Find Patent Forward Citations

Loading…